Bitcoin functions as a sound digital foundation for the future global economy, acting as indestructible digital property rather than a mere medium of exchange. While traditional financial systems rely on digital credit—which is slow, high-friction, and loses value through repeated transactions—Bitcoin provides a high-fidelity monetary base capable of moving capital at the speed of light. This protocol serves as the "granite of Manhattan" for the cyber economy, offering a way to manifest capital in an immortal, indestructible form. By transitioning from credit-based systems to this digital energy, humanity can defeat inflation and process transactions a million times faster and cheaper than current banking networks. This transformation represents a fundamental shift in civilization's power source, moving from the metaphorical "animal power" of legacy finance to the "electrical power" of a programmable, digital monetary system.
